Key Elements of Effective Property Marketing


Effective property marketing combines several elements that work together to create a compelling story around your listing. Here’s what you need to focus on:


1. High-Quality Visuals


Buyers start with visuals. Use professional photography and video tours to showcase the property’s best features. Include:


  • Wide-angle shots of rooms and exterior

  • Close-ups of unique details like fixtures or finishes

  • Drone footage for large properties or developments


Visuals should be bright, clear, and well-composed. Avoid clutter and distractions in the frame.


2. Compelling Property Descriptions


Write clear, concise descriptions that highlight benefits, not just features. Instead of “3 bedrooms, 2 baths,” say “Spacious 3-bedroom home with two modern bathrooms perfect for family living.” Use bullet points for easy scanning.


3. Targeted Online Advertising


Use social media ads and search engine marketing to reach buyers in your target area and demographic. Platforms like Facebook and Google allow precise targeting by location, age, interests, and more.


4. Virtual Tours and Open Houses


Virtual tours let buyers explore the property from anywhere. Combine these with live or in-person open houses to engage serious prospects.


5. Strong Call to Action


Every marketing piece should include a clear call to action. Examples:


  • “Schedule a tour today”

  • “Contact us for pricing details”

  • “Visit our website for more listings”


6. Consistent Branding


Use consistent logos, colors, and messaging across all marketing materials. This builds recognition and trust over time.


By combining these elements, you create a marketing campaign that attracts attention and converts interest into offers.


How much should a realtor spend on marketing?


Budgeting for marketing is critical. Spend too little, and your property may languish unsold. Spend too much, and your profit margins shrink. Here’s how to approach it:


  • Set a percentage of the listing price: Many experts recommend allocating 1% to 3% of the property’s asking price to marketing.

  • Consider the property type and market: Luxury homes or new developments may require a higher budget for premium marketing.

  • Prioritize high-impact tactics: Invest in professional photography, online ads, and virtual tours first.

  • Track your ROI: Monitor which marketing efforts generate leads and sales. Adjust your budget accordingly.


For example, if you list a $500,000 home, a $5,000 to $15,000 marketing budget is reasonable. This covers quality visuals, targeted ads, and open house events.


Remember, marketing is an investment that pays off by reducing time on market and increasing sale price.

Actionable Tips to Boost Your Property Sales Today


You don’t have to wait to improve your marketing. Start with these actionable steps:


  1. Audit your current listings: Review photos, descriptions, and online presence. Identify weak spots.

  2. Invest in professional visuals: Hire a photographer or videographer for your next listing.

  3. Create a marketing calendar: Plan when and where you will promote each property.

  4. Use social media strategically: Post regularly, engage with followers, and run targeted ads.

  5. Host virtual tours: Use platforms like Matterport or Zoom to showcase properties remotely.

  6. Follow up promptly: Respond quickly to inquiries and nurture leads.

  7. Track results: Use tools like Google Analytics and CRM reports to see what works.


Implementing these tips consistently will increase your visibility and attract serious buyers.
